Routing is one of the most important challenges in Vehicular Ad hoc Networks (VANETs). These networks involve a high cost in the real world experimentation. Thus, simulation is a useful alternative in conducting such a research. In this paper, two important routing protocols (AODV and DSDV) have been considered for testing in VANET environments. Performance evaluation has been accomplished for these two routing protocols using the CityMob mobility generator that generates the required urban mobility scenario files. Then, simulation has been done based on these scenario files using the NS-2 simulator. The performance of the routing protocols has been compared based on some routing metrics (Packet Delivery Ratio and End to End Delay) for different values for the speed of vehicles. The work has been done under Linux operating system.
